What is the theory behind laser hair reduction?

        Laser technology is based on highly concentrated rays. These rays are concentrated on a specific part of your skin from where you wish to remove the hair. The highly concentrated light is directed to particular hair follicles in order to remove them. Although, permanent results or results that last a lifetime are never guaranteed, cases have been observed wherein after a few sessions, complete hair loss is observed.

What all lasers available for hair reduction?    

       Many types of laser removal procedures are available, among these, Neodymium YAG, diode(commonly used), alexandrite, and intense pulsed light sources are well known.

check list before you get laser hair removal

  • Treating doctor should be a qualified Dermatologist with a MD, DVD, DNB in dermatology
  • There is no degree called cosmetology and hence beware of someone projecting as cosmetologist with out MCI recognised dermatology degree
  • US FDA machines should be used to give effective results , kindly check for that
  • If u have tanned skin , it has to be treated first
  • Donot do any parlour activities befor and after the treatment
  • Waxing and threading should not be done prior to treatment
  • Hairs will be shaved off as lasers target roots, and shaving doesnt make ur hair thick
